Oceania > Kiribati > Health

I-KIRIBATI HEALTH STATS:   Top Stats   All Stats  
View this page with:    Just Stats   Sources   Definitions   Both  
% immunized 1-year-old children > DPT3 99 [9th of 187]
% immunized 1-year-old children > HepB3 99 [4th of 114]
% immunized 1-year-old children > Measles 88 [94th of 186]
% immunized 1-year-old children > Polio3 96 [55th of 187]
% immunized 1-year-old children > TB 99 [8th of 153]
% of population using adequate sanitation facilities > Rural 44 [96th of 140]
% of population using adequate sanitation facilities > Total 48 [116th of 144]
% of population using adequate sanitation facilities > Urban 54 [131st of 141]
% of population using improved drinking water sources > Rural 25 [142nd of 146]
% of population using improved drinking water sources > Total 48 [133rd of 150]
% of population using improved drinking water sources > Urban 82 [116th of 147]
Abortion law > Australasia and Oceania > Mental Health No
Abortion law > Australasia and Oceania > Physical Health No
Birth rate, crude > per 1,000 people 27.7 per 1,000 people Time series [66th of 195]
Births attended by skilled health staff > % of total 88.9 % Time series [44th of 76]
Contraceptive prevalence > % of women ages 15-49 21 % Time series [26th of 57]
Dependency ratio per 100 67 [70th of 166]
Drinking water availability % 48% [130th of 147]
expenditure per capita > current US$ 111.9 $ Time series [103rd of 186]
expenditure, private > % of GDP 0.96 % Time series [166th of 187]
expenditure, public > % of GDP 12.74 % Time series [2nd of 187]
expenditure, total > % of GDP 13.7 % Time series [3rd of 187]
External resources for health > % of total expenditure on health 27.9 % Time series [21st of 141]
External resources for health as % of total expenditure on health 3% [79th of 179]
Fertility rate, total > births per woman 3.6 births per woman Time series [64th of 194]
Healthy life expectancy at birth, years > Females 55.6 [130th of 186]
Healthy life expectancy at birth, years > Males 52.3 [137th of 186]
Healthy life expectancy at birth, years > Total population 54 [133rd of 186]
Hospital beds > per 1,000 people 1.8 per 1,000 people Time series [56th of 149]
Immunization, DPT > % of children ages 12-23 months 62 % Time series [174th of 190]
Immunization, measles > % of children ages 12-23 months 56 % Time series [177th of 190]
Improved sanitation facilities > % of population with access 40 % Time series [129th of 167]
Improved sanitation facilities, rural > % of rural population with access 22 % Time series [144th of 167]
Improved sanitation facilities, urban > % of urban population with access 59 % Time series [135th of 173]
Improved water source > % of population with access 65 % Time series [139th of 176]
Improved water source, rural > % of rural population with access 53 % Time series [141st of 174]
Improved water source, urban > % of urban population with access 77 % Time series [165th of 181]
Incidence of tuberculosis > per 100,000 people 380 per 100,000 people Time series [16th of 200]
Infant mortality rate 49.9 [52nd of 179]
Infant mortality rate > Female 39.53 deaths/1,000 live births Time series [61st of 225]
Infant mortality rate > Male 49.61 deaths/1,000 live births Time series [59th of 225]
Infant mortality rate > Total 44.69 deaths/1,000 live births Time series [60th of 225]
life expectancy > Date of information 2006 est.
Life expectancy at birth > Female 66.06 years Time series [166th of 226]
Life expectancy at birth > Male 59.79 years Time series [175th of 226]
Life expectancy at birth > Total population 62.85 years Time series [172nd of 225]
Life expectancy at birth, female > years 66 years Time series [131st of 194]
Life expectancy at birth, male > years 59.8 years Time series [140th of 194]
Life expectancy at birth, total > years 62.82 years Time series [135th of 194]
Life expectancy at birth, years > Females 67 [124th of 186]
Life expectancy at birth, years > Males 62 [122nd of 186]
Life expectancy at birth, years > Total population 65 [120th of 186]
Malnutrition prevalence, height for age > % of children under 5 28.3 % Time series [3rd of 52]
Malnutrition prevalence, weight for age > % of children under 5 12.9 % Time series [6th of 63]
Nutrition > % of children who are   exclusively breastfed 6 months 80 [4th of 125]
Nutrition > % of under-fives suffering from stunting moderate & severe 28 [48th of 132]
Nutrition > % of under-fives suffering from underweight moderate & severe 13 [76th of 137]
Nutrition > % of under-fives suffering from wasting moderate & severe 11 [26th of 128]
Out-of-pocket expenditure as % of private health expenditure 100% [8th of 185]
Out-of-pocket health expenditure > % of private expenditure on health 100 % Time series [29th of 185]
Per capita government expenditure on health in international dollars 139 [101st of 185]
Per capita total expenditure on health in international dollars 141 [127th of 185]
Physicians > per 1,000 people 0.3 per 1,000 people Time series [72nd of 148]
Pregnant women receiving prenatal care > % 88 % Time series [4th of 62]
Prepaid plans as % of private expenditure on health 0% [110th of 159]
Prevalence of undernourishment > % of population 7 % Time series [93rd of 172]
Private expenditure on health as % of total expenditure on health 1.2% [186th of 185]
Probability of dying before 5 > Females 74 per 1,000 people [61st of 187]
Smoking prevalence, females > % of adults 32.3 % Time series [1st of 43]
Smoking prevalence, males > % of adults 56.5 % Time series [5th of 42]
Tobacco > Adult female smokers 32.3 [8th of 114]
Tobacco > Adult male smokers 56.5 [20th of 115]
Tobacco > Total adult smokers 42 [11th of 121]
Total expenditure on health as % of GDP 8% [40th of 185]
Total fertility rate 4 [53rd of 166]
Tuberculosis cases detected under DOTS > % 72.99 % Time series [57th of 178]
Tuberculosis treatment success rate > % of registered cases 94.37 % Time series [10th of 171]
